diff --git a/windows/msvc/bufr_dump/bufr_dump.vcxproj b/deprecated/windows/msvc/bufr_dump/bufr_dump.vcxproj similarity index 100% rename from windows/msvc/bufr_dump/bufr_dump.vcxproj rename to deprecated/windows/msvc/bufr_dump/bufr_dump.vcxproj diff --git a/windows/msvc/bufr_dump/bufr_dump.vcxproj.filters b/deprecated/windows/msvc/bufr_dump/bufr_dump.vcxproj.filters similarity index 100% rename from windows/msvc/bufr_dump/bufr_dump.vcxproj.filters rename to deprecated/windows/msvc/bufr_dump/bufr_dump.vcxproj.filters diff --git a/windows/msvc/bufr_filter/bufr_filter.vcxproj b/deprecated/windows/msvc/bufr_filter/bufr_filter.vcxproj similarity index 100% rename from windows/msvc/bufr_filter/bufr_filter.vcxproj rename to deprecated/windows/msvc/bufr_filter/bufr_filter.vcxproj diff --git a/windows/msvc/bufr_filter/bufr_filter.vcxproj.filters b/deprecated/windows/msvc/bufr_filter/bufr_filter.vcxproj.filters similarity index 100% rename from windows/msvc/bufr_filter/bufr_filter.vcxproj.filters rename to deprecated/windows/msvc/bufr_filter/bufr_filter.vcxproj.filters diff --git a/windows/msvc/grib_api.sln b/deprecated/windows/msvc/grib_api.sln similarity index 100% rename from windows/msvc/grib_api.sln rename to deprecated/windows/msvc/grib_api.sln diff --git a/windows/msvc/grib_api_lib/grib_api_lib.vcxproj b/deprecated/windows/msvc/grib_api_lib/grib_api_lib.vcxproj similarity index 100% rename from windows/msvc/grib_api_lib/grib_api_lib.vcxproj rename to deprecated/windows/msvc/grib_api_lib/grib_api_lib.vcxproj diff --git a/windows/msvc/grib_api_lib/grib_api_lib.vcxproj.filters b/deprecated/windows/msvc/grib_api_lib/grib_api_lib.vcxproj.filters similarity index 100% rename from windows/msvc/grib_api_lib/grib_api_lib.vcxproj.filters rename to deprecated/windows/msvc/grib_api_lib/grib_api_lib.vcxproj.filters diff --git a/windows/msvc/grib_compare/grib_compare.vcxproj b/deprecated/windows/msvc/grib_compare/grib_compare.vcxproj similarity index 100% rename from windows/msvc/grib_compare/grib_compare.vcxproj rename to deprecated/windows/msvc/grib_compare/grib_compare.vcxproj diff --git a/windows/msvc/grib_compare/grib_compare.vcxproj.filters b/deprecated/windows/msvc/grib_compare/grib_compare.vcxproj.filters similarity index 100% rename from windows/msvc/grib_compare/grib_compare.vcxproj.filters rename to deprecated/windows/msvc/grib_compare/grib_compare.vcxproj.filters diff --git a/windows/msvc/grib_copy/grib_copy.vcxproj b/deprecated/windows/msvc/grib_copy/grib_copy.vcxproj similarity index 100% rename from windows/msvc/grib_copy/grib_copy.vcxproj rename to deprecated/windows/msvc/grib_copy/grib_copy.vcxproj diff --git a/windows/msvc/grib_copy/grib_copy.vcxproj.filters b/deprecated/windows/msvc/grib_copy/grib_copy.vcxproj.filters similarity index 100% rename from windows/msvc/grib_copy/grib_copy.vcxproj.filters rename to deprecated/windows/msvc/grib_copy/grib_copy.vcxproj.filters diff --git a/windows/msvc/grib_dump/grib_dump.vcxproj b/deprecated/windows/msvc/grib_dump/grib_dump.vcxproj similarity index 100% rename from windows/msvc/grib_dump/grib_dump.vcxproj rename to deprecated/windows/msvc/grib_dump/grib_dump.vcxproj diff --git a/windows/msvc/grib_dump/grib_dump.vcxproj.filters b/deprecated/windows/msvc/grib_dump/grib_dump.vcxproj.filters similarity index 100% rename from windows/msvc/grib_dump/grib_dump.vcxproj.filters rename to deprecated/windows/msvc/grib_dump/grib_dump.vcxproj.filters diff --git a/windows/msvc/grib_filter/grib_filter.vcxproj b/deprecated/windows/msvc/grib_filter/grib_filter.vcxproj similarity index 100% rename from windows/msvc/grib_filter/grib_filter.vcxproj rename to deprecated/windows/msvc/grib_filter/grib_filter.vcxproj diff --git a/windows/msvc/grib_filter/grib_filter.vcxproj.filters b/deprecated/windows/msvc/grib_filter/grib_filter.vcxproj.filters similarity index 100% rename from windows/msvc/grib_filter/grib_filter.vcxproj.filters rename to deprecated/windows/msvc/grib_filter/grib_filter.vcxproj.filters diff --git a/windows/msvc/grib_get/grib_get.vcxproj b/deprecated/windows/msvc/grib_get/grib_get.vcxproj similarity index 100% rename from windows/msvc/grib_get/grib_get.vcxproj rename to deprecated/windows/msvc/grib_get/grib_get.vcxproj diff --git a/windows/msvc/grib_get/grib_get.vcxproj.filters b/deprecated/windows/msvc/grib_get/grib_get.vcxproj.filters similarity index 100% rename from windows/msvc/grib_get/grib_get.vcxproj.filters rename to deprecated/windows/msvc/grib_get/grib_get.vcxproj.filters diff --git a/windows/msvc/grib_get_data/grib_get_data.vcxproj b/deprecated/windows/msvc/grib_get_data/grib_get_data.vcxproj similarity index 100% rename from windows/msvc/grib_get_data/grib_get_data.vcxproj rename to deprecated/windows/msvc/grib_get_data/grib_get_data.vcxproj diff --git a/windows/msvc/grib_get_data/grib_get_data.vcxproj.filters b/deprecated/windows/msvc/grib_get_data/grib_get_data.vcxproj.filters similarity index 100% rename from windows/msvc/grib_get_data/grib_get_data.vcxproj.filters rename to deprecated/windows/msvc/grib_get_data/grib_get_data.vcxproj.filters diff --git a/windows/msvc/grib_ls/grib_ls.vcxproj b/deprecated/windows/msvc/grib_ls/grib_ls.vcxproj similarity index 100% rename from windows/msvc/grib_ls/grib_ls.vcxproj rename to deprecated/windows/msvc/grib_ls/grib_ls.vcxproj diff --git a/windows/msvc/grib_ls/grib_ls.vcxproj.filters b/deprecated/windows/msvc/grib_ls/grib_ls.vcxproj.filters similarity index 100% rename from windows/msvc/grib_ls/grib_ls.vcxproj.filters rename to deprecated/windows/msvc/grib_ls/grib_ls.vcxproj.filters diff --git a/windows/msvc/grib_set/grib_set.vcxproj b/deprecated/windows/msvc/grib_set/grib_set.vcxproj similarity index 100% rename from windows/msvc/grib_set/grib_set.vcxproj rename to deprecated/windows/msvc/grib_set/grib_set.vcxproj diff --git a/windows/msvc/grib_set/grib_set.vcxproj.filters b/deprecated/windows/msvc/grib_set/grib_set.vcxproj.filters similarity index 100% rename from windows/msvc/grib_set/grib_set.vcxproj.filters rename to deprecated/windows/msvc/grib_set/grib_set.vcxproj.filters